Hi Abel,

On 3/13/2026 6:53 PM, Abel Vesa wrote:
> Introduce the initial support for the Qualcomm Eliza SoC. It comes in
> different flavors. There is SM7750 for mobiles and then QC7790S/M for IoT.
> Describe the common parts under a common dtsi.
>
> The initial submission enables support for:
> - CPU nodes with cpufreq and cpuidle support
> - Global Clock Controller (GCC)
> - Resource State Coordinator (RSC) with clock controller & genpd provider
> - Interrupt controller
> - Power Domain Controller (PDC)
> - Vendor specific SMMU
> - SPMI bus arbiter
> - Top Control and Status Register (TCSR)
> - Top Level Mode Multiplexer (TLMM)
> - Debug UART
> - Reserved memory nodes
> - Interconnect providers
> - System timer
> - UFS
>

> +
> + ice: crypto@1d88000 {
> + compatible = "qcom,eliza-inline-crypto-engine",
> + "qcom,inline-crypto-engine";
> + reg = <0x0 0x01d88000 0x0 0x18000>;
> +
> + clocks = <&gcc GCC_UFS_PHY_ICE_CORE_CLK>;

As per the updated ABI for eliza and milos which I am proposing with this patch,
we should have two clocks (core & iface) and a power-domain here:

https://lore.kernel.org/all/20260317-qcom_ice_power_and_clk_vote-v3-2-53371dbabd6a@x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x/
